Transaction 95b571f4a0f803442a6e763d9e0380d811c3370c34fcc08f8b6261c8e9714bbe
1 Input
1 Output
-
95b571f4a0f803442a6e763d9e0380d811c3370c34fcc08f8b6261c8e9714bbe:0
- value
- 633771
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 25fa2be5fa249286558c775b36f9ad5da9147e03 OP_EQUAL
- address
- 359pcrrxnMLZWSWEVsiThjytzivDEJp9vb